Man kann auch die
GUID/UUID als ID nutzen, auch für Syncro,
und zusätzlich noch einen INT/BIGINT für die Lokalen Verknüfungen.
In der Syncro nutzen wir eine TimeStamp/
GUID
aber intern wird mit INT oder BIGINT (aber als VARCHAR(32) gespeichert) verlinkt.
Werden abhängige Tabellen Syncronisiert, muß man dann die internen und externen IDs umrechnen.
bzw. bei einigen (älteren) Tabellen, die früher nur über den INT (AUTOINC) verlinkt und syncronisiert wurden,
hatte ich die Syncro zuletzt so umgestellt, dass ein/mehrere andere Spalten als eindeutige "SyncID" genommen werden und der INT nur intern verbleibt (auf allen Datenbanken unterschiedlich).